Grand Canyon Educations’ Faculty Development department is seeking a full time Faculty Specialist.  This position will assist with the research, planning, and facilitation of faculty development training and workshops that focus on best practices in higher education pedagogy in order to enhance teaching and student learning in the traditional campus classrooms. This position will be responsible for supporting both the online faculty and the ground faculty.

Please Note, this is a Hybrid Role, where you’ll work from home and in the office, 1 day a week.

What you will do:

  • Facilitate, evaluate, and document faculty training events.  Review, process, and document faculty evaluations. 

  • Conduct classroom investigations, coach faculty as necessary and document outcomes 

  • Supporting faculty in classroom management, teaching strategies, effective feedback practices, and other various aspects of higher education teaching 

  • Work collaboratively with college teams to train, support and develop effective instructors through data analysis, development events, and strategic meetings

  • Assist in planning and facilitating professional development in Higher Ed pedagogy for faculty

  • Research topics, trends, etc. and plans, prepares and delivers training, classroom, presentation, workshop, and/or e-learning courses. 

  • Other duties as assigned

What you will need:

  • Master’s degree in a related field from an accredited institution required

  • Experience working in post-secondary setting preferred

  • 3-5 years post-secondary teaching experience

  • Must work evenings and weekends as needed

  • Must pass pre-employment background investigation
